Transaction c3d3f3eecc6c40929e39a94349fb7524a2deba2d912172dcca41916aaf8cc666
1 Input
1 Output
-
c3d3f3eecc6c40929e39a94349fb7524a2deba2d912172dcca41916aaf8cc666:0
- value
- 621302
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c0e36e641cccaa697544d86a93f973faeaa81848 OP_EQUAL
- address
- 3KGv7aBzf77yXaMgWXeAzfV7u3KFUa81zh